2016-05-03 82 views
3

多くの複雑な依存関係を持つNodeJSプログラムがあります。NodeJSでEHOSTUNREACHの原因を見つける方法は?

時々EHOSTUNREACHABLEでクラッシュしていたので、process.on('uncaughtException' ...ハンドラを追加しました。

元のクラッシュもキャッチエラーも、(アプリケーションコードではなく)NodeJSコードからスローされた非同期例外であるため、問題の発生場所を示すものではありません。

{ [Error: connect EHOSTUNREACH] 
    code: 'EHOSTUNREACH', 
    errno: 'EHOSTUNREACH', 
    syscall: 'connect' } 

NodeJSが作成しているsyscallで詳細を見つける方法はありますか?理想的には、私は到達不能なリモートIPアドレスを知りたいと思います。

答えて

関連する問題